Daniel Crowley and Timothy Killen will consider aspects of joint insurance, with a focus on issues which arise in the context of construction projects and tenancy agreements. The talk will include an analysis of the recent decision of the Supreme Court in Gard Marine and Energy Limited v China National Chartering Company Limited (the “Ocean Victory”) [2017] UKSC 35 and provide some pointers as to the current state of the law in this area. The talk will be introduced by Neil Moody KC.

This seminar will be most useful to those who practise in construction, insurance, property damage and professional negligence.
